Kriaka works with leadership teams in New Zealand businesses who have an objective or a pressure that AI might change, and who would act if the evidence supported it.
You do not need an approved project or a settled question. You do need the authority to act on the answer, and a willingness to let us see how the relevant work actually happens.
What the first conversation covers.
You will talk to Bryce Galbraith, Kriaka's founder. There is no charge for it.
We will cover what the business is trying to achieve, why it matters now, what would have to be true for you to act, and whether Kriaka is the right firm to help. You will leave with a straight answer on whether a formal assessment is justified.
It is not an audit, a workflow-mapping session or a demonstration, and we will not recommend an investment on the strength of one conversation.
What happens next.
If there is a fit, we will propose an AI Operating Strategy Assessment: the decision it will answer, the evidence we will need, what we need from your team, and what it will cost.
If the problem is too small, too early, already covered by a provider you have, or outside what Kriaka does well, we will say so.
